On the flip side, I’ve also encountered some challenges. For instance, integrating my SimpliSafe security system wasn’t as straightforward as I hoped. I tried following the official guide, but kept running into issues where the integration wouldn’t complete. After some troubleshooting and reaching out to the support team, I discovered that a simple firmware update on my hub was all it took to get everything working smoothly. Moral of the story? Sometimes, a fresh start or a quick update can make all the difference.
If you’re looking to integrate a new device, here are a few tips to keep in mind:
- Do your research: Before diving in, take some time to read through existing forum posts or official documentation. Someone might have already encountered and solved the issue you’re facing.
- Check for updates: Ensure your devices and hubs are running the latest firmware. Outdated software can often be the root of integration issues.
- Start small: If you’re new to integration, begin with a single device or two and gradually expand your setup. This way, you can troubleshoot any issues without feeling overwhelmed.
- Don’t be afraid to ask for help: Whether it’s on forums like this or through official support channels, don’t hesitate to reach out when you’re stuck.
